What Is the Grandmother Hypothesis and What Does It Say About Menopause?

In most mammals, lifespan closely tracks with fertility: when reproductive capacity ends, survival tends to drop soon after. In humans, women commonly live several decades beyond menopause, a pattern that puzzled evolutionary biologists for years. This led to what is now known as the “grandmother hypothesis,” first articulated in detail by anthropologist Kristen Hawkes and colleagues in the 1990s.

The core idea is simple: women who live past their reproductive years increase the survival of their grandchildren and, in doing so, increase the spread of their genes through the population. In hunter‑gatherer groups, older women often played a key role in gathering and processing hard‑to‑access foods (like tubers or nuts) that young children could not obtain on their own. By contributing reliable calories and care, grandmothers allowed their daughters to have shorter birth intervals and more surviving children overall.

Longer post‑menopausal life, in this view, carried a clear evolutionary advantage. It was selected for because communities with living grandmothers did better than those without them. Menopause, then, is not the beginning of biological irrelevance; it is the opening of a new, historically crucial role.

The hypothesis was formally published in Proceedings of the National Academy of Sciences in 1998 and has since been supported by demographic studies across multiple hunter-gatherer and pastoral populations. (Hawkes et al., PNAS, 1998)

What Do Anthropological Studies Show About the Role of Grandmothers?

Ethnographic and demographic studies in traditional societies have repeatedly shown that the presence of grandmothers is associated with better outcomes for grandchildren. In some pastoral and foraging communities, children with a living maternal grandmother have higher survival rates and better nutritional status than those without.

Grandmothers contribute in several practical ways:

  • They act as nutritional anchors, gathering, preparing, and distributing food during times of scarcity. They are often the anchor of food traditions, passing on recipes and cooking the main dish that they ate as children.

  • They serve as keepers of skills and culture, passing on knowledge about plants, seasons, healing practices, conflict resolution, and spiritual life. Often, it's grandma who passes on language and cultural traditions.

  • They function as steady voices in family dynamics, helping to regulate social tensions and mediate disputes.

  • They provide caregiving support not only for young children, but also for aging spouses, siblings, and community members.

  • They contribute to strategic decision‑making: when to move, how to respond to threat, how to allocate scarce resources.

In environments where survival depended on cooperation and shared memory, experienced women were not peripheral. They were central to stability. And still are.

What Happens to the Brain After Menopause?

Modern neuroscience adds another layer to this picture. While estrogen and progesterone decline after menopause, the brain does not simply “power down.” It reorganizes.

Studies of aging brains show that, for many women, certain cognitive and emotional capacities strengthen with age:

  • Emotional regulation often improves, with older adults showing less reactivity to negative stimuli and greater capacity to recover from stress.

  • Pattern recognition and “big‑picture” thinking can become more refined, as decades of lived experience allow women to see connections and long‑term consequences more clearly.

  • Integrative thinking - the ability to hold nuance and reconcile conflicting information - tends to deepen over time.

In other words, the ability to draw on a lifetime of knowledge and emotional learning increases with age. Years of experience do not make women invisible; they make them uniquely capable of guiding others.

Why Is Intergenerational Connection Biologically Important?

Health research also supports the idea that intergenerational connection is not just “nice to have”; it is biologically meaningful. Older adults who stay engaged in meaningful roles - caring for grandchildren, volunteering, mentoring, helping in community settings - often show better mental health, lower rates of cognitive decline, and greater overall well‑being.

Children also benefit from regular contact with engaged grandparents or older adults. They gain additional emotional support, learn stories and skills that anchor them in a larger narrative, and often experience more stability when families face financial or relational stress.

Taken together, the biology and the anthropology point in the same direction: women are not meant to be sidelined after menopause. They are meant to remain woven into the fabric of community life. What is the Grandmother Hypothesis? The Grandmother Hypothesis is an evolutionary theory proposing that women live long past menopause because post-reproductive women historically increased the survival of their grandchildren and communities. First formally articulated by anthropologist Kristen Hawkes in the 1990s, it suggests that menopause is not a biological endpoint but an evolutionary transition into a new, strategically important life phase.

Why do humans go through menopause when most animals don't? Most mammals die shortly after their reproductive years end. Humans — along with orcas and a few other species, are exceptions. The leading evolutionary explanation is that post-reproductive females contribute so much to group survival through caregiving, knowledge transfer, and resource gathering that living beyond fertility increases the genetic success of the group as a whole.

Does the brain get worse after menopause? Not necessarily. While estrogen and progesterone decline, research shows that many cognitive and emotional capacities strengthen with age, including emotional regulation, pattern recognition, integrative thinking, and the ability to hold nuance. The post-menopausal brain reorganizes rather than simply declining.
